Tomatoes Are Expensive? Try These 10 Alternatives
The price of tomatoes has been on the rise for months, and it shows no signs of slowing down. In fact, the average price of a tomato has reached a record high of ₹ 130 a kilo in Bangalore and its vicinity. This is due to a number of factors, including a poor growing season, early monsoon, increased demand, and supply chain disruptions.
